Cash PrizeFormerly known as Food Photographer of the Year, the World Food Photography Awards is a unique photography competition celebrating the very best in food photography from around the world.
Open to professional and non-professional photographers, you can win prestige, prize money and commercial opportunities by taking part in the world's most important food photography awards.
